Sarah Prescott is an Instructor of Music at Beloit College, specializing in piano performance and pedagogy. She holds a B.A. in Music from the University of Chicago (2014) and an M.M. in Piano Performance and Pedagogy from the University of Wisconsin-Madison (2020). She is currently pursuing a doctorate in piano performance and pedagogy at UW-Madison, studying under Jessica Johnson.

Her teaching expertise includes class piano instruction and private piano lessons. She coordinates undergraduate group piano classes at UW-Madison and has taught at Farley’s House of Pianos since 2016. Her professional focus emphasizes music pedagogy and the intersection of performance practice with educational methodologies.
